Question
Why do you think Anagha’s mother wanted her to know the story of the Buddha?
Advertisements
Solution
Buddha was the founder of Buddhism and he was the Wise One. His stories could be inspirational and motivational to students. So Anagha‘s mother wanted her to know his story.
